Boaters use bottom paint to reduce friction, enhance speed, improve fuel efficiency and protect fiberglass and metals continually exposed. This type of paint is usually applied to the bottom of the boat and is available in two types: Antifouling paint is designed to prevent marine organisms, such as barnacles and algae, from attaching to the hull of the boat. Hard epoxy paint, and soft ablative paints that slowly slough off and expose new biocides with use.
